We're currently recruiting in our Wadebridge Premier Inn. Working 16 hours per week, paying up to £13.16 per hour.
Come and be a Nights Team Member at Premier Inn in Wadebridge. As the go-to for our hotel overnight guests, use your calm personality to ensure their safety and your customer service skills to help them rest easy and get that good night’s sleep with us. Immediate start, no experience needed.
Up to £13.16 per hour.
Fixed Term until 26/02/26. Over 18s only.
16 hours per week across 2 nights – weekends included.
Premier Inn Wadebridge, Gonvena Hill, Wadebridge, Cornwall, PL27 6BN.
Join our team at Premier Inn Wadebridge as a Nights Team Member and look after our hotel and guests overnight. Bring your problem‑solving skills, health and safety knowledge and be part of the UK’s leading hospitality business, Whitbread.
